본 발명은 구근류 절단장치에 관한 것으로, 더욱 상세하게는 구근류의 절단작업중 회전판 내에 구근류가 접착되지 않도록 유도하여 절단작업의 생산성을 현저히 향상시키도록 구성되는 구근류 절단장치에 관한 것이다.The present invention relates to a bulbous cutting device, and more particularly, to a bulbous cutting device is configured to significantly improve the productivity of the cutting operation by inducing the bulbs in the rotating plate during the cutting operation of the bulbs.

등록특허공보 제246960호에 기재된 구근류 절단장치는 도1에 도시한 바와 같이 모터(미도시)의 구동력이 풀리(2)를 통해 회전판(3)에 전달되면 베이스(1)상에서 회전판이 회전되면서 안내블록(6)을 회전시키게 된다.The bulbous cutting device described in Korean Patent No. 246960 is guided as the rotating plate rotates on the base 1 when the driving force of the motor (not shown) is transmitted to the rotating plate 3 through the pulley 2 as shown in FIG. The block 6 is rotated.

이때, 투입호퍼(5)를 통해 회전판(3) 위에 투입되는 홍삼 등과 같은 구근류는 회전판의 원심력에 의해 안내블록(6)의 유도면(6-2)을 밀착상태로 이동하게 된다.At this time, the bulbs such as red ginseng, which is introduced onto the rotating plate 3 through the feeding hopper 5 moves the guide surface 6-2 of the guide block 6 in close contact by the centrifugal force of the rotating plate.

여기서, 도2에 도시한 바와 같이 회전판(3) 상의 구근류는 회전판(3)의 원심력에 의해 안내블록(6)의 유도면(6-2)을 따라 출구(6-1)측으로 이동하게 되고, 출구측으로 돌출되는 순간 절단칼날(8)에 의해 순간적으로 얇게 썰어지게 된다.Here, as shown in FIG. 2, the bulbs on the rotating plate 3 move toward the outlet 6-1 along the guide surface 6-2 of the guide block 6 by the centrifugal force of the rotating plate 3, At the moment of protruding to the exit side, it is instantaneously thinly cut by the cutting blade 8.

그러나, 상기 구근류 절단장치는 회전판(3) 상의 구근류가 회전판의 원심력에 의해 안내블록(6)의 유도면(6-2)에 밀착되고, 작업이 진행될수록 그 구근류의 밀착량이 증가하면서 종국적으로 출구(6-1)가 막히는 현상이 종종 발생된다.However, in the bulb cutting device, the bulb on the rotating plate 3 is brought into close contact with the guide surface 6-2 of the guide block 6 by the centrifugal force of the rotating plate, and as the work progresses, the amount of adhesion of the bulb is increased and eventually exits. Clogging of (6-1) often occurs.

따라서, 종래에는 절단작업중 수시로 모터의 작동을 멈추고 안내블록(6)의 유도면(6-2)에 고착되어 출구(6-1)를 막고 있는 구근류를 제거한 후, 다시 모터를 구동하는 번거로운 청소작업을 절단작업중 거의 1분간격으로 반복 실시하게 된다.Therefore, in the related art, the motor is frequently stopped during the cutting operation, the bulb is stuck to the guide surface 6-2 of the guide block 6 to remove the bulbs blocking the outlet 6-1, and the cumbersome cleaning operation to drive the motor again. The process is repeated at about 1 minute intervals during the cutting operation.

이처럼, 상기 구근류 절단장치는 절단대상인 구근류가 회전판(3)의 원심력에 의해 안내블록(6)의 유도면(6-2)에 고착되는 구조적 결함때문에 절단작업의 효율성 등을 현저히 저하시키고, 절단작업에 과다한 부하에 걸리는 등의 문제가 있다.As such, the bulbous cutting device significantly lowers the efficiency of the cutting operation due to structural defects in which the bulbous target to be cut is fixed to the guide surface 6-2 of the guide block 6 by the centrifugal force of the rotating plate 3, There is a problem such as excessive load.

본 발명은 상기한 종래기술의 문제를 개선하기 위하여 안출된 것으로, 각 고정안내블록의 각 내측꼭지부에 유성기어롤을 설치하면서 4개의 유성기어롤이 회전판과 함께 공전하는 과정에서 덮개의 선기어와의 치결합에 의해 회전판과 동일한 회전방향으로 자전하도록 구성되는 구근류 절단장치를 제공함에 그 목적이 있다.The present invention has been made in order to solve the above problems of the prior art, while the planetary gear rolls are installed on each inner top of each fixed guide block while the four planetary gear rolls revolve with the rotating plate and the sun gear of the cover It is an object of the present invention to provide a bulbous cutting device configured to rotate in the same rotational direction as the rotating plate by tooth coupling.

상기한 목적을 달성하기 위하여 본 발명은 베이스와, 상기 베이스의 중앙에 설치되면서 커버의 투입호퍼를 통해 투입되는 구근류를 회전원심력을 이용하여 절단칼날측으로 배출하는 회전판과, 상기 회전판 상에 고정되면서 가변안내편과 함께 절단유도로를 형성하는 고정안내블록과, 상기 회전판의 외주면을 따라 상기 베이스에 설치되는 가변펜스,로 이루어지는 공지의 구근류 절단장치에 있어서, 상기 커버의 하부 중앙에 고정 구비되면서 그 외주면에 기어가 형성되는 선기어와; 상기 고정안내블록의 각 내측꼭지부에 위치하도록 상기 회전판에 설치되고, 그 기어부가 상기 선기어와 치결합되면서 상기 회전판과 함께 공전하는 동시에 상기 선기어를 따라 자전을 하여 그 롤부가 구근류를 각 절단유도로(35)로 유도하는 다수의 유성기어롤;로 구성되는 것을 특징으로 하는 구근류 절단장치를 제공하게 된다.In order to achieve the above object, the present invention is installed in the center of the base, and the rotary plate discharged to the cutting blade side by using a rotary centrifugal force is injected through the input hopper of the cover, and fixed while being fixed on the rotating plate In the known bulbous cutting device consisting of a fixed guide block for forming a cutting guide together with the guide piece, and a variable fence installed on the base along the outer peripheral surface of the rotating plate, the outer peripheral surface is fixed to the lower center of the cover A sun gear having a gear formed thereon; It is installed on the rotating plate so as to be located on each inner nipple of the fixed guide block, the gear portion is engaged with the sun gear while revolving with the rotating plate and rotating along the sun gear, the roll portion is to guide the bulbs to each cutting guide It provides a bulbous cutting device, characterized in that consisting of; a plurality of planetary gear rolls leading to (35).

이상과 같이 구성되는 본 발명은 회전판상에 고착된 구근류를 제거하기 위한 청소작업이 불필요하고, 이에 따라 구근류 절단작업의 효율성을 극대화할 수 있을 뿐만 아니라 구근류의 신속한 이송에 따른 작업의 생산성을 높일 수 있는 등의 효과를 제공하게 된다.The present invention constituted as described above does not require a cleaning operation for removing the bulbs fixed on the rotating plate, thereby maximizing the efficiency of the bulb cutting operation and increasing the productivity of the work due to the rapid transport of the bulbs. To provide the effect.

이하에서는 첨부된 도면을 참조하여 본 발명의 바람직한 실시예를 상세히 설명하기로 한다.Hereinafter, with reference to the accompanying drawings will be described a preferred embodiment of the present invention;

본 발명은 그 일 실시예에 따르면, 도3 및 도4에 도시한 바와 같이 회전판(30) 상에 고정 설치되면서 투입호퍼(5)를 통해 투입되는 구근류를 절단칼날(40)측으로 안내하는 다수의 고정안내블록(31)과, 회전판 상에 각 고정안내블록(31)과 나란히 설치되면서 구근류의 크기에 따라 고정안내블록과의 사이에 형성되는 절단유도로(35)의 폭을 조정하도록 구비되는 가변안내편(32)과; 각 고정안내블록의 내측꼭지부에 위치하도록 회전판 상에 설치되는 유성기어롤(33)과; 커버(7)의 하부 중앙에 고정 설치되면서 고정되면서 유성기어롤과 치결합하는 선기어(33);로 구성되어 있다.According to one embodiment of the present invention, as shown in FIGS. 3 and 4, a plurality of guiding bulbs introduced through the feeding hopper 5 while being fixedly installed on the rotating plate 30 to the cutting blade 40 side. Fixed guide block 31 and the variable guide provided on the rotating plate side by side with the fixed guide block 31 is provided to adjust the width of the cutting guide 35 formed between the fixed guide block according to the size of the bulbs A guide piece 32; A planetary gear roll 33 installed on the rotating plate so as to be positioned at an inner corner of each fixed guide block; It is fixed while being installed fixed to the lower center of the cover (7) Sun gear 33 which is coupled with the planetary gear roll; consists of.

이때, 고정안내블록(31)은 회전판(30)의 상면 외측편을 따라 90°의 회전대칭이 이루어지도록 구비되어 있고, 가변안내편(32)은 고정안내블록(31) 사이에 위치하도록 회전판 상에 설치되면서 회전이 가능하도록 구비되어 있다.At this time, the fixed guide block 31 is provided so that the rotation symmetry of 90 ° along the outer surface of the upper surface of the rotating plate 30, the variable guide piece 32 is located on the rotating plate to be located between the fixed guide block 31 It is provided to be rotated while being installed in.

여기서, 고정안내블록(31)과 가변안내편(32) 사이에 각각 절단유도로(35)가 형성되고, 이 절단유도로는 절단할 구근류의 크기에 따라 가변안내편에 의해 그 폭이 조정되도록 구성되어 있다.Here, the cutting guide 35 is formed between the fixed guide block 31 and the variable guide piece 32, the width of the cutting guide is adjusted by the variable guide piece according to the size of the bulb to be cut. Consists of.

특히, 절단유도로(35)는 투입호퍼(5)를 통해 회전판(30) 상에 투입된 구근류를 회전판의 원심력에 의해 절단칼날(40)측으로 유도하도록 구성되어 있고, 유도되는 구근류의 크기에 따라 가변안내편(32)의 회전에 의해 그 폭의 크기가 조절되도록 구성되어 있다.In particular, the cutting flow path 35 is configured to guide the bulbs introduced on the rotating plate 30 through the feeding hopper 5 toward the cutting blade 40 by the centrifugal force of the rotating plate, and varies according to the size of the induced bulbs. The width of the width is adjusted by the rotation of the guide piece 32.

그리고, 유성기어롤(33)은 각 고정안내블록(31)의 내측꼭지부에 위치하도록 회전판(30)에 설치되어 투입호퍼(5)를 통해 회전판(30) 상에 투입된 구근류가 원심력에 의해 방사상으로 퍼져 이동할 때 가장 먼저 접촉하도록 구성되어 있다.In addition, the planetary gear roll 33 is installed on the rotary plate 30 so as to be positioned at the inner corner of each fixed guide block 31, and the bulbs introduced onto the rotary plate 30 through the feeding hopper 5 are radial by centrifugal force. It is configured to be the first to contact when spreading.

여기서, 선기어(34)는 커버(7)의 하부 중앙에 구비되면서 커버와 함께 고정상태를 이루게 되고, 그 외주면을 따라 형성되는 기어가 4개의 유성기어롤(33)과 치결합되도록 구성되어 있다.Here, the sun gear 34 is provided in the lower center of the cover 7 to form a fixed state together with the cover, the gear formed along the outer peripheral surface is configured to be engaged with the four planetary gear roll (33).

따라서, 회전판(30)과 함께 공전하는 유성기어롤(33)은 고정상태의 선기어(34)를 따라 회전판과 동일한 방향으로 자전하면서 회전판과 동일한 방향의 공전이 이루어지도록 구성되어 있다.Therefore, the planetary gear roll 33 revolving together with the rotating plate 30 is configured to rotate in the same direction as the rotating plate while rotating in the same direction as the rotating plate along the fixed sun gear 34.

여기서, 유성기어롤(33)은 기어부(33-1)와 롤부(33-2)로 이루어지는데, 상부측에 구비되는 기어부(33-1)는 선기어(34)와 치결합되고, 기어부의 외경보다 작은 외경을 가지면서 기어부의 하부측에 구비되는 롤부(33-2)는 구근류와 접촉하여 각 절단유도로(35)로 안내하게 된다.Here, the planetary gear roll 33 is composed of a gear portion 33-1 and a roll portion 33-2, the gear portion 33-1 provided on the upper side is engaged with the sun gear 34, the gear The roll part 33-2 provided on the lower side of the gear part while having an outer diameter smaller than that of the negative part is brought into contact with the bulbs to guide each cutting guide 35.

이때, 유성기어롤(33)은 그 외주면에 회전판(30) 상의 구근류와 접하게 되고, 회전판과 반대방향으로 자전되면서 원심력에 의해 밀착되는 구근류를 접선방향으로 밀어내어 구근류가 고정안내블록(31)에 접착되지 않도록 차단하는 동시에 각 절단유도로(35)로 신속하게 안내하도록 작용하게 된다.At this time, the planetary gear roll 33 is in contact with the bulbs on the rotating plate 30 on the outer peripheral surface, and rotates in the opposite direction to the rotating plate to push the bulbs in close contact with the centrifugal force in the tangential direction so that the bulbs are fixed to the fixed guide block 31. It blocks to prevent adhesion and acts to guide quickly to each cutting guide 35.

이처럼, 각 절단유도로(35)로 유도된 구근류는 다시 회전판(30)의 원심력에 의해 가변펜스(25)의 내측면에 밀착되어 있다가 절단칼날(40)에 의해 순간적으로 썰어지면서 잘게 절단이 이루어진 후, 대략 "ㄱ"자형으로 절곡된 수거원통관(41)을 통해 수거되도록 구성되어 있다.In this way, the bulbs induced in each cutting flow path 35 is in close contact with the inner surface of the variable fence 25 by the centrifugal force of the rotating plate 30 again, and then cut finely while being instantaneously cut by the cutting blade 40. After being made, it is configured to be collected through the collection tube 41 bent in a substantially "b" shape.

요컨대, 본 발명에서는 각 고정안내블록(31)의 내측꼭지부에 유성기어롤(33)을 설치하면서 유성기어롤이 회전판(30)과 함께 공전하는 과정에서 커버(7)의 하부중앙에 구비된 선기어(34)와 치결합하여 회전판(30)의 회전방향으로 자전하도록 구성하고, 유성기어롤의 자전은 회전원심력에 의해 유성기어롤의 외주면에 밀착되는 회전판의 구근류를 접착되지 않도록 유도하는 동시에 각 절단유도로(35)로 신속하게 안내함으로써 구근류의 절단효율을 현저히 증대시킬 수 있도록 구성하는 데에 그 기술적 특징이 있다할 것이다.In other words, in the present invention, the planetary gear roll 33 is installed at the inner top of each fixed guide block 31 while the planetary gear roll revolves together with the rotating plate 30. It is configured to rotate in the rotational direction of the rotary plate 30 by tooth coupling with the sun gear 34, and the rotation of the planetary gear roll guides the bulbs of the rotating plate that are in close contact with the outer circumferential surface of the planetary gear roll by the rotational centrifugal force to prevent adhesion. There will be technical features in the construction to be able to significantly increase the cutting efficiency of the bulb by guiding to the cutting guide 35 quickly.
